Output e34a73f4e2baac4fde73fb81d67fbe2274eaa0cf78adeb32c0a7d4d7449b054f:173

value
516529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 71ae46592726b5febadeb5d5f43a3c11b2300162 OP_EQUALVERIFY OP_CHECKSIG
address
1BN68W7ystRcnbyPfWCbnQkNxRT83grZVa
transaction
e34a73f4e2baac4fde73fb81d67fbe2274eaa0cf78adeb32c0a7d4d7449b054f
confirmations
192899
spent
true